Analysis of Facial Bone Wall Dimensions and Sagittal Root Position in the Maxillary Esthetic Zone: A Retrospective Study Using Cone Beam Computed Tomography

The facial bone wall in most maxillary anterior teeth was very thin. There was a substantial sagittal angulation between the long axes of teeth and those of their respective alveolar bone in most esthetic zone positions. CBCT analyses of the facial bone wall and the sagittal angle are recommended to ensure the most appropriate dental implant treatment approach.
